ClusterArgs

data class ClusterArgs(val configuration: Output<ClusterConfigurationArgs>? = null, val name: Output<String>? = null, val serviceConnectDefaults: Output<ClusterServiceConnectDefaultsArgs>? = null, val settings: Output<List<ClusterSettingArgs>>? = null, val tags: Output<Map<String, String>>? = null) : ConvertibleToJava<ClusterArgs>

Provides an ECS cluster.

Example Usage

package generated_program;
import com.pulumi.Context;
import com.pulumi.Pulumi;
import com.pulumi.core.Output;
import com.pulumi.aws.ecs.Cluster;
import com.pulumi.aws.ecs.ClusterArgs;
import com.pulumi.aws.ecs.inputs.ClusterSettingArgs;
import java.util.List;
import java.util.ArrayList;
import java.util.Map;
import java.io.File;
import java.nio.file.Files;
import java.nio.file.Paths;
public class App {
public static void main(String[] args) {
Pulumi.run(App::stack);
}
public static void stack(Context ctx) {
var foo = new Cluster("foo", ClusterArgs.builder()
.settings(ClusterSettingArgs.builder()
.name("containerInsights")
.value("enabled")
.build())
.build());
}
}

Example with Log Configuration

package generated_program;
import com.pulumi.Context;
import com.pulumi.Pulumi;
import com.pulumi.core.Output;
import com.pulumi.aws.kms.Key;
import com.pulumi.aws.kms.KeyArgs;
import com.pulumi.aws.cloudwatch.LogGroup;
import com.pulumi.aws.ecs.Cluster;
import com.pulumi.aws.ecs.ClusterArgs;
import com.pulumi.aws.ecs.inputs.ClusterConfigurationArgs;
import com.pulumi.aws.ecs.inputs.ClusterConfigurationExecuteCommandConfigurationArgs;
import com.pulumi.aws.ecs.inputs.ClusterConfigurationExecuteCommandConfigurationLogConfigurationArgs;
import java.util.List;
import java.util.ArrayList;
import java.util.Map;
import java.io.File;
import java.nio.file.Files;
import java.nio.file.Paths;
public class App {
public static void main(String[] args) {
Pulumi.run(App::stack);
}
public static void stack(Context ctx) {
var exampleKey = new Key("exampleKey", KeyArgs.builder()
.description("example")
.deletionWindowInDays(7)
.build());
var exampleLogGroup = new LogGroup("exampleLogGroup");
var test = new Cluster("test", ClusterArgs.builder()
.configuration(ClusterConfigurationArgs.builder()
.executeCommandConfiguration(ClusterConfigurationExecuteCommandConfigurationArgs.builder()
.kmsKeyId(exampleKey.arn())
.logging("OVERRIDE")
.logConfiguration(ClusterConfigurationExecuteCommandConfigurationLogConfigurationArgs.builder()
.cloudWatchEncryptionEnabled(true)
.cloudWatchLogGroupName(exampleLogGroup.name())
.build())
.build())
.build())
.build());
}
}

Import

Using pulumi import, import ECS clusters using the name. For example:

$ pulumi import aws:ecs/cluster:Cluster stateless stateless-app

val name: Output<String>? = null

Name of the cluster (up to 255 letters, numbers, hyphens, and underscores)

val settings: Output<List<ClusterSettingArgs>>? = null

Configuration block(s) with cluster settings. For example, this can be used to enable CloudWatch Container Insights for a cluster. Detailed below.

val tags: Output<Map<String, String>>? = null

Key-value map of resource tags. If configured with a provider default_tags configuration block present, tags with matching keys will overwrite those defined at the provider-level.
